  • 1 Solomon’s Officials So King Solomon was king over all Israel.
  • 2 These were his officials:Azariah the son of Zadokwasthe priest;
  • 3 Elihoreph and Ahijah, the sons of Shishawerescribes;Jehoshaphat the son of Ahiludwasthe recorder;
  • 4 and Benaiah the son of Jehoiadawasover the army;and Zadok and Abiatharwerepriests;
  • 5 and Azariah the son of Nathanwasover the deputies;and Zabud the son of Nathan, a priest,wasthe king’s friend;
  • 6 and Ahisharwasover the household;and Adoniram the son of Abdawasover the men subject to forced labor.
  • 7 Now Solomon had twelve deputies over all Israel, who sustained the king and his household; each man had to sustainthemfor a month in the year.
  • 8 These are their names:Ben-hur, in the hill country of Ephraim;
  • 9 Ben-deker in Makaz and Shaalbim and Beth-shemesh and Elonbeth-hanan;
  • 10 Ben-hesed, in Arubboth (Socohwashis and all the land of Hepher);
  • 11 Ben-abinadab,inall 4:11Or Naphoth-dor the height of Dor (Taphath the daughter of Solomon was his wife);
  • 12 Baana the son of Ahilud,inTaanach and Megiddo, and all Beth-shean which is beside Zarethan below Jezreel, from Beth-shean to Abel-meholah as far as the other side of Jokmeam;
  • 13 Ben-geber, in Ramoth-gilead (now 4:13Or the towns of Jair Havvoth-Jair—Jair beingthe son of Manasseh—which is in Gilead was his: the region of Argob, which is in Bashan, sixty great cities with walls and bronze barswerehis);
  • 14 Ahinadab the son of Iddo,inMahanaim;
  • 15 Ahimaaz, in Naphtali (he also married Basemath the daughter of Solomon);
  • 16 Baana the son of Hushai, in Asher and 4:16Or in Aloth Bealoth;
  • 17 Jehoshaphat the son of Paruah, in Issachar;
  • 18 Shimei the son of Ela, in Benjamin;
  • 19 Geber the son of Uri, in the land of Gilead, the country of Sihon king of the Amorites and of Og king of Bashan; andhe wasthe only deputy whowasin the land.Judah’s and Israel’s Abundance and Security
  • 20 Judah and Israelwereas numerous as the sand that is on the 4:20 Lit sea seashore in abundance;theywere eating and drinking and being glad.
  • 21 4:21Ch5:1in Heb Now Solomon ruled over all the kingdoms from the 4:21The Euphrates River Rivertothe land of the Philistines and to the border of Egypt;theybrought tribute and served Solomon all the days of his life.
  • 22 And Solomon’s 4:22Lit bread provision for one day was 4:22Approx. 195 bu. or6.9metric tons, a kor was approx.6.5bu. or 230 l thirty kors of fine flour and 4:22Approx. 390 bu. or13.8metric tons sixty kors of meal,
  • 23 ten fat oxen, twenty 4:23Lit oxen of the pasture pasture-fed oxen, one hundred sheep besides deer, gazelles, roebucks, and fattened fowl.
  • 24 For he had dominion over everything 4:24 Lit beyond west of the 4:24 The Euphrates River River, from Tiphsah even to Gaza, over all the kings 4:24 Lit beyond west of the 4:24 The Euphrates River River; and he had peace on all sides around about him.
  • 25 So Judah and Israel lived in security, every man under his vine and his fig tree, from Dan even to Beersheba, all the days of Solomon.
  • 26 Solomon had 4:26One ms4,000,cf. 2 Chr 9:2540,000stalls of horses for his chariots, and12,000horsemen.
  • 27 And these deputies sustained King Solomon and all who came to King Solomon’s table, each in his month; they left nothing lacking.
  • 28 They also brought barley and straw for the horses and swift steeds to the place where it should be, each according to thelegaljudgment for him.
  • 29 And God gave Solomon wisdom and very great discernment and breadth ofunderstandinginhisheart, like the sand that is on the seashore.
  • 30 And Solomon’s wisdom surpassed the wisdom of all the sons of the east and all the wisdom of Egypt.
  • 31 And he was wiser than all men, than Ethan the Ezrahite, Heman, Calcol, and 4:31In 1 Chr 2:6,Dara Darda, the sons of Mahol; andthe renown ofhis name was in all the surrounding nations.
  • 32 He also spoke3,000proverbs, and his songs were1,005.
  • 33 And he spoke of trees, from the cedar that is in Lebanon even to the hyssop that grows on the wall; he spoke also of animals and birds and creeping things and fish.
  • 34 4:34Lit they And men came from all peoples to hear the wisdom of Solomon, from all the kings of the earth who had heard of his wisdom.
